Law firms deal with money that must be handled with care, structure, and clear rules. Each matter brings fees, costs, retainers, and time records that must align with legal and ethical standards. Law firm accounting services help legal practices move beyond basic record keeping into clear financial control. Instead of reacting to numbers at month end, firms gain steady insight into how money moves each day. With proper law firm accounting, legal teams know where funds come from, where they go, and how they affect firm health. Strong law firm accounting services reduce guesswork and replace it with clear financial direction.
Modern law firm accounting services are built to support planning, control, and long term stability. They help firms see which cases support growth and which drain time and cash. Proper law office accounting keeps trust funds separate, tracks earned income correctly, and aligns records with real activity. With expert accounting services for lawyers, firms reduce risk linked to errors, missed rules, or poor tracking. Outsourced law accounting services bring structure and calm to daily finance tasks. Lawyers spend less time reviewing numbers and more time serving clients, while financial systems run smoothly in the background.

Establishing fixed daily and weekly bookkeeping routines helps ensure that financial tasks are completed on time without last minute pressure. When teams follow a consistent process, entries remain accurate and fewer items are overlooked. Regular routines also reduce confusion during reviews and reporting. Over time, this consistency strengthens overall financial discipline.
Keeping all financial information within one organized system prevents data gaps and duplicate records. A centralized structure improves accuracy and makes reviews faster and more reliable. It also allows better coordination between billing, trust tracking, and reporting. Clear data flow supports confident financial decisions.
Each financial entry should include clear notes, dates, and case references to explain its purpose. Detailed descriptions make reviews easier and reduce the need for follow up checks. This approach supports audit readiness and billing accuracy. Well explained records improve long term clarity.
Limiting access to financial records helps protect sensitive information and prevents accidental changes. Defined access roles ensure that only authorized users can edit critical data. This control improves accountability across the firm. Strong access rules also support data security.
Ongoing reviews during the month help confirm that records stay accurate and complete. Small issues can be corrected early without disrupting reporting schedules. Regular review reduces pressure at month end. This practice keeps financial records stable.
Grouping expenses by purpose rather than only by date provides better insight into spending patterns. This structure makes it easier to identify rising costs and inefficiencies. Clear expense grouping supports better budgeting. Firms gain stronger cost awareness.
Billing systems should closely match accounting records to avoid mismatches between work performed and amounts charged. Strong alignment improves invoice accuracy and reduces payment delays. This also supports cleaner client communication. Better alignment leads to smoother revenue flow.
Trust account movements should always include clear reasons, approvals, and supporting details. Proper documentation supports compliance and simplifies reviews. It also protects client funds from misuse or confusion. Detailed records strengthen ethical handling.
Spreading preparation tasks across the month reduces errors and last minute stress. Regular updates keep records current and reliable. Reports become easier to finalize on schedule. This approach improves accuracy and confidence.
Vendor records should be reviewed frequently to confirm pricing, timing, and accuracy. Early review helps avoid overpayments or disputes. Clean vendor records support smooth operations. Strong oversight builds professional trust.
Tracking case related expenses separately from general firm costs improves billing clarity and profit analysis. Each matter reflects its true financial impact. This separation supports fair billing practices. Clients receive clearer cost explanations.
Receipts and financial documents should be stored securely with easy access for review. Proper storage reduces audit risk and delays. Organized files save time during checks. Secure systems protect long term records.
Setting fixed internal reporting dates helps teams plan and stay consistent. Predictable reporting improves coordination across departments. Leaders rely on timely data. This supports informed decision making.
Regular internal reviews help verify accuracy and consistency across records. Issues are identified before they affect compliance or reporting. Reviews strengthen internal controls. Reliable data supports firm stability.

Goods and Service tax (GST) is levied on sales of all the goods and services in Australia. GST is generally chargeable at 10% of value of sales.
